Two men sentenced to prison after police arrest for an attempted robbery during a car sale. A firearm was confiscated from the criminals.

The victim reacted quickly and called the police; a patrol in the area responded to the call. Officers pursued the criminals who were fleeing in a car and managed to apprehend them shortly after the robbery. It was during a routine search that the officers found, in the possession of one of the suspects, a firearm with its magazine and three live rounds, which is presumed to be the one used to threaten the victim. After contacting the victim through the digital Marketplace platform to sell a car, the criminals lured her to the area known as El Colmenar, supposedly to carry out the transaction. Upon arriving at the location, the suspects, covering their faces with scarves, threatened the victim, held her at gunpoint with a firearm carried by one of them, and robbed her of cash and a necklace. Panama - 144 and 84 months in prison were sentenced, through a plea agreement, two men for the crimes of robbery and illegal possession of a firearm, after being apprehended last Friday following a false purchase of a vehicle. During the multiple requests hearing, representatives of the Second Section of Crimes against Economic Heritage of the Metropolitan Prosecutor's Office presented sufficient evidence linking them to the incident that occurred on December 5 in El Colmenar, located in the Ernesto Córdoba Campos district.
